IAA Annual Day of Service


Date: October 18, 2022
Time: 7:30 – 3:00
Location: Camp Mathieu, 25W501 Butterfield Rd, Wheaton, IL

Description of work: Removals and pruning (large deadwood 2” & greater, elevation, crown reduction and crown elevation)

PPE required: we will follow all ANSI Z133-3017 Standards, head protection meeting ANSI Z89 Standards, eye protection meeting ANSI Z87 Standards, work boots covering the ankle and providing ankle support, hearing protection, chainsaw leg protection while using a chainsaw on the ground.

Personnel required: Aerial lift operators, groundspersons, climbers.

Equipment needed: Tracked and wheeled lift units (high priority), aerial lift trucks, chippers and trucks, 4 X 4 pickups, 1 grapple truck.

Scope of work: A lot of removals, most need to be topped, some need to be rigged; clearing of lights on utility poles, vine removal off of structures, large deadwood pruning.

Most of the work is tree removal with topping. Very few ‘notch and drops’.

Chip and log disposal on site
